Rotted Windows

Wooden window frames can begin to rot and lead to the need for a costly replacement. In some cases it is possible to have rot repaired. However, in the majority of cases, it is best to replace the whole unit. You can avoid this expense by observing for early signs of warping or swelling. Caulking is also a method to fix wavy or bubbled paint, which is an indication that there is moisture within the frame.

It is essential to immediately take action if you notice any of these signs. In the absence of rotting trim around windows, it could cause structural damage and could compromise the integrity of your home. In addition, it can make your home more vulnerable to termite infestations as well as other pest problems.

window-repair.jpegIn order to prevent decay, you must ensure that your windows are properly sealed and weatherproofed. Sealing the space between the window and the wall will also prevent water from entering the window frame. You should also examine the condition of your window frames on a regular schedule as wood rot is an extremely serious issue, particularly when exposed to humidity.

A wooden window that has a spongy appearance is the most obvious indication of decay. It can be difficult to detect, but a simple test using a screwdriver will help to diagnose the problem. Simply insert the tip of the screwdriver into the sill or the lower part of the window and observe whether the wood appears soft and spongy. If so, it is likely that the frame has been rotted.

You can also spot the signs of rot by watching for changes in how your window functions. Rotted wood is evident if your window seems to be difficult to open or shut, or if it rattles when you use it. The process of rotting causes wood to shrink as it attacks the cellulose.

If the rot is limited to a tiny portion of a window frame it could be possible for the wood to be repaired by cutting off the affected area and replacing it with a new piece of timber. However, it is generally cheaper and easier to replace the whole window in the event that the rot has accelerated.

Broken Glass

Even if it's a small issue, the appearance of cracked glass on the windows of your home can detract from its aesthetic appeal. Additionally, it could cause security issues for the home and cause unfavorable changes in the temperature of the room. It is crucial to fix the damage fast to avoid these problems and to preserve the value of the home. Fortunately, some minor cracks can be repaired without the need to replace the entire window. The type of crack you have and the way you deal with it will determine the outcome.

It is important to clean the area thoroughly prior to applying the repair substance. This will ensure that it adheres well. To accomplish this, you can use glass cleaner and cotton cloth. Acetone (often found as nail polish remover), can be used to clean stubborn spots and oily residues.

You can apply clear nail polish to the crack once the glass has been cleaned and dried. This will temporarily stop the expansion of the crack and help to unite all the broken pieces. You can then use epoxy to repair the damaged surface. It's important to follow the instructions on the packaging to mix it properly and then apply it evenly on the surface of the glass that has been damaged. Once the epoxy is dry, you can make use of a sharp blade to remove excess and smooth the finish.

Sagging Doors

When a door sags and tilts downwards, it is opened. This causes an imbalance that can affect the door's ability to fit into its frame and to close properly. Fortunately, this common problem is simple to fix with a few simple steps.

Begin by examining the hinges on the door and frame. If the screws that hold them in place are loose tighten them using a screwdriver. If the holes have been stripped, opt for longer screws that are able to better grip the wood and avoid any future issues. You can also use shims - small wedge-shaped pieces - to adjust the angle of the hinge. This will help alleviate a sagging front door.

A jamb or frame that is damaged is another reason for a sagging front door. Examine the frame for cracks and splits which could be causing the door to slide. If you find gaps, repair them by using a patching compound or wood filler to strengthen the frame and stop further damage.

The last thing to do is check the strike plate on your frame to ensure it is aligned with the door latch. Also, make sure it is secure. If it isn't then reposition it by loosing the plate and reattaching using new screws.

If you're unable to fix a sagging front door, it might be time to replace it. A high-quality door will last longer and resist sagging of the door over time. If your door is continuously falling down, you may have to consult an engineer who can identify the root cause, such as foundation settlement or damage from moisture.
